While There’s Still Time: An Urgent Call To Pray For America

Have you ever wondered what is happening in America? Do you sometimes remember better times and think, How did we get into this mess? More importantly, would you like to know what you can do to help stem the tide of evil engulfing our land? We are in a national crisis. The building blocks of our society are slowly but steadily being dismantled and cast aside. The Bible, on which our government and legal system are based, and the Christian faith, that makes our form of government work, have been discarded as outdated and unreliable. Belief in the sanctity of human life that establishes the value of every individual, Christian morality that sustains an orderly society, and a Biblical work ethic that has prospered us beyond any nation on earth are no longer the values of America. In June of 2015, the Supreme Court ruled that same sex marriage is a right guaranteed by the Constitution. In an unprecedented ruling, the most fundamental institution of American society-marriage and family life-was redefined by judicial decree. In light of these seismic, societal changes, many Christians have given up hope. Others remain hopefully optimistic while the question on everyone’s heart is that raised by the psalmist: If the foundations be destroyed, what can the righteous do? (Ps. 11:3) If the building blocks of our society-the faith, values, institutions, and conventions on which America was established-are destroyed, what can the people of God do? This volume explores the answer to the psalmist’s question and offers a clear challenge for Christians to do what only we can do.
